Faculty Tenure Process

The faculty tenure process is a system in academic institutions where faculty members are evaluated and granted permanent employment after a probationary period.

Key Features

  • Evaluation of teaching, research, and service
  • Peer review
  • Criteria for tenure eligibility
  • Tenure-track positions
  • Probationary period

Pros

  • Provides job security for qualified faculty members
  • Encourages academic excellence and professional development
  • Fosters institutional stability and continuity

Cons

  • Can be a lengthy and stressful process for faculty members
  • May lead to competition and tension among colleagues
  • Potential for bias or subjectivity in evaluation
